Chocolate Covered Coffee Beans 1
1/3 C roasted Whole Coffee Beans 1/2 C Chocolate Chips
Melt the chocolate in a double boiler until liquid and smooth. Drop in a handful of beans, and stir them around. Scoop them out with a spoon, and set them out on waxed paper. Keep them separate. Continue until all the beans are covered. They will harden overnight, or if you are in a hurry, you can freeze them for about half an hour. Once hard, they won't stick together and can be stored in any air-tight container.
Chocolate Covered Coffee Beans 2
1 C roasted Coffee Beans 4 oz Chocolate Pieces 3 T Cocoa Powder
Melt the chocolate and cover the beans, using the technique in Recipe #1. Let them harden a little, but not completely. Roll the chocolate beans in the cocoa powder, and then let them finish hardening. I don't normally recommend flavoured coffees, but they can add a tasty twist to these treats. Try hazelnut or vanilla.
